EXCEEDS logo
Exceeds
Barabanov

PROFILE

Barabanov

Alexander Barabanov engineered robust CI/CD automation and security enhancements for the open-edge-platform/datumaro repository, focusing on workflow reliability, code quality, and governance. He implemented automated dependency management, integrated security scanning with Bandit, Trivy, and CodeQL, and modernized pipeline configurations using Python, YAML, and Shell scripting. His work included hardening runners, refining linting thresholds, and streamlining documentation deployment, which improved build reproducibility and reduced maintenance overhead. By updating CODEOWNERS and consolidating dependency updates, Alexander clarified code ownership and accelerated review cycles. The depth of his contributions strengthened security posture, reduced technical debt, and enabled safer, more predictable releases across the project.

Overall Statistics

Feature vs Bugs

100%Features

Repository Contributions

72Total
Bugs
0
Commits
72
Features
15
Lines of code
4,113
Activity Months7

Work History

September 2025

14 Commits • 3 Features

Sep 1, 2025

September 2025 monthly summary for open-edge-platform/datumaro. Focused on delivering security- and governance-oriented improvements, with an emphasis on dependency hygiene, CI/CD security, and code ownership clarity. The work reduced risk, improved maintainability, and supported faster delivery cycles across the project.

August 2025

6 Commits • 5 Features

Aug 1, 2025

Month: 2025-08 — Datumaro repo focused on security hardening, reliability, and quality controls. Key features delivered include: (1) CI/CD security hardening with hardened-runner across multiple GitHub Actions workflows to audit outbound calls and strengthen the CI/CD security posture; (2) CI/CD security scanning actions updated to new repository paths under the geti-ci organization (Zizmor, Bandit, Trivy) and removal of dependency freezing steps to simplify the build; (3) addition of the OpenSSF Scorecard badge to the README to communicate the project's security posture to users; (4) documentation deployment workflow improvements to correctly handle release versions and the latest symlink, with a more robust checkout process; and (5) linting thresholds tuning to lower the severity and confidence requirements, reducing noise from less critical findings.

July 2025

12 Commits • 2 Features

Jul 1, 2025

July 2025 monthly summary for open-edge-platform/datumaro: Delivered enhancements to Rust security scanning and CI/CD automation, focusing on CodeQL analysis, autobuild workflows, and security tooling integration. Strengthened PR governance and reduced pipeline churn while improving security posture.

May 2025

11 Commits • 1 Features

May 1, 2025

May 2025 focused on stabilizing and modernizing the Datumaro repository CI/CD pipeline to deliver faster, more reliable releases and reduce maintenance overhead. The work emphasized predictability, clearer ownership, and streamlined deployment of documentation.

March 2025

5 Commits • 1 Features

Mar 1, 2025

Monthly summary for 2025-03: Focused on enhancing security, reliability, and maintainability of the open-edge-platform/datumaro CI/CD pipeline. Delivered consolidated CI/CD pipeline hardening and quality enhancements, including a Python runtime upgrade, explicit secret handling, dependency pinning, and workflow formatting cleanup. No distinct major bugs fixed this month; the effort centered on risk reduction and code quality improvements. Impact: reduced time-to-detect and fix issues in CI, more reproducible builds, and stronger security posture across pipelines. Technologies/skills demonstrated: Python, CI/CD tooling, static analysis readiness, secret management, and dependency management.

February 2025

23 Commits • 2 Features

Feb 1, 2025

February 2025 Monthly Summary for open-edge-platform development efforts, focusing on CI/CD security enhancements and governance across two repositories (open-edge-platform/datumaro and open-edge-platform/geti-sdk). Implemented consolidated security scanning with SARIF outputs for Trivy and Bandit, expanded CodeQL analyses to Python and workflow files, stabilized scan artifacts, introduced SPDX SBOM generation, and added dependency review workflows with scheduling. Also modernized CodeQL workflows and applied OS/runtime updates to strengthen security posture. Result: improved risk visibility, faster remediation, and stronger governance across the CI/CD pipelines.

January 2025

1 Commits • 1 Features

Jan 1, 2025

January 2025: Implemented Dependabot automation for GitHub Actions in open-edge-platform/geti-sdk to automatically scan weekly for updates, improving security and reducing manual maintenance. No major bugs fixed this month. Impact: more secure, up-to-date workflows enabling faster, safer CI/CD releases. Technologies/skills demonstrated: GitHub Actions, Dependabot, automation tooling.

Activity

Loading activity data...

Quality Metrics

Correctness89.6%
Maintainability90.8%
Architecture87.8%
Performance83.6%
AI Usage20.0%

Skills & Technologies

Programming Languages

BashINIMarkdownPythonShellTOMLTextYAML

Technical Skills

BanditCI/CDCode AnalysisCode FormattingCode LintingCode QualityCodeQLConfiguration ManagementContribution GuidelinesDependency ManagementDevOpsDocumentationGitHub ActionsMachine LearningPython

Repositories Contributed To

2 repos

Overview of all repositories you've contributed to across your timeline

open-edge-platform/datumaro

Feb 2025 Sep 2025
6 Months active

Languages Used

BashINIPythonShellYAMLTOMLMarkdownText

Technical Skills

BanditCI/CDCodeQLConfiguration ManagementDependency ManagementDevOps

open-edge-platform/geti-sdk

Jan 2025 Feb 2025
2 Months active

Languages Used

YAMLPythonShell

Technical Skills

CI/CDDependency ManagementDevOpsCode AnalysisGitHub ActionsSecurity Scanning

Generated by Exceeds AIThis report is designed for sharing and indexing